Stop to Bloody Activity in Gymnasium

Under so-called body suspension, hooks are pulled through the skin of the participants, who are then hoisted into the air, hanging in their own skin. Now, Ängelholm municipality is putting a stop to the rental of a gym to the activity, citing that it is too bloody, reports HD/Sydsvenskan.

It is an activity that perhaps more belongs in a circus or a variety show, but nothing that we can allow in a gym where both children's parties and sports lessons are held, says Peter Björkqvist, unit manager for bathing, sports, and leisure, to the newspaper.

About ten people have, for 14 years, rented a gym in the municipality to engage in body suspension. The couple Viveca Svensson and Jesper Botoft explain that they are very particular about hygiene. They have never left blood or hooks behind and have never tried to conceal what type of activity it is from the municipality.

We usually do a summer hanging and a winter hanging, says Jesper Botoft to the newspaper.

The municipality states that it is on the advice of the National Board of Health and Welfare that the rental is terminated.
